The Diablo 4: Lord of Hatred expansion will be released on April 27 in the United States and on April 28 in Europe, Asia, and Australia. Players can preload the expansion starting April 23 at 4 pm PDT on Battle.net, Xbox, and PlayStation, but not on Steam. Patch 3.0, which includes updates to class skill systems and unique items, can also be preloaded separately.

Diablo 4: Lord of Hatred introduces a revamped endgame experience with eight distinct classes, including the new Warlock class, which combines spellcasting and summoning abilities. The narrative centers on the protagonist's relationship with Lilith and the threat posed by Mephisto, set against the backdrop of the visually striking region of Skovos, inspired by Grecian architecture. The game features enhanced customization options, improved class skill trees, and a new War Plans system that revitalizes the endgame experience. However, the overarching story is criticized for its pacing and character development, particularly regarding the Amazons and the reliance on Lilith. Despite these critiques, the campaign offers visually stunning boss encounters and a compelling soundtrack. The game raises questions about its future direction, with concerns about evolving into a live-service model.
